OM5 multimode fibre.

Also written wideband multimode, lime green fibre, SWDM fibre.

What is OM5 fibre for?

Carrying several wavelengths on one multimode fibre, so a 100 gigabit link that would need eight OM4 fibres runs on two OM5 ones. It is the lime green fibre, backward compatible with OM4 at every ordinary speed, and worth its premium only in a data centre planning wavelength-division transceivers. For a campus or a building backbone, OM4 or single mode does the same job for less.

Defined by ISO/IEC 11801, which defines the OM5 cabled category, published by ISO/IEC.
